The study on Youth participation in Democratic life is now available online!
There is a growing dissatisfaction among young people with the way politics work according to the Study realised by the London School of Economics on Youth participation in Democratic life.
Young people want to participate in politics.
Young people also request more information about politics and elections and consider specific institutional settings that could improve their participation and representation.
